程序员怎样提升自己的薪资?
这个问题嘛,你直接去北上广等一线城市就行了(这当然是在和大家开玩笑),下面才是码宝宝的一些建议,有其他建议的请积极提出哦。
时刻准备提升自我
说真的,想要涨工资都必须要学习,再学习!这话老套但是实用。用老乔(乔布斯)的话来说就是“保持饥饿,保持愚蠢”。因为这个社会随时在更新,所以在这个社会生存的你也毕业时刻准备提升自己,每天或每周抽出一天时间来进行学习。
至于学习,也建议你不要盲目,不是说什么火就去学什么,而最好是深入掌握数据结构和算法,再或者学习一些你所在公司愿意付钱的技术,而不是只学习你喜欢的技术。
当然,也不是说你就只学一种语言了,语言决定世界观,你如果是一名Java程序员,那么还是建议你学一学Python、C++等语言,这样可以扩展你的思维方式和技能树,掌握底层原理。
aba66fcd88f6450f9ff66092b7390785.jpg认真思考是否要跳槽
有人说程序员的涨薪一半来自跳槽,码宝宝告诉你这是真的,根据去年某网数据统计,在国内跳槽Java程序员中,跳槽后的程序员成功涨薪的占比是70%左右,而未选择跳槽的Java程序员中,薪资基本无提升的程序员占比高达40%。
为啥跳槽会比内部加薪高,因为一般的公司里都有严格的薪酬体系和晋级模式,除了一些创业公司,一般企业薪资幅度一般在15%左右,越级晋升很难。但是如果你想通过跳槽来涨薪资却不难,于是大家都想跳,公司从用人角度出发也喜欢挖人注入新鲜血液。
有很重要的一点需要大家注意,如果你只是单纯的为了涨工资而跳槽,码宝宝还是不建议的。因为你如果在一个好的团队,有一个号的前景的时候,随着企业价值的提升,你的身价也在增值,不是单纯的薪资变动,这也需要自己认真考虑。
如果是想去创业型公司
有些人在大企业呆久了,想去创业型的小公司,这种公司很有发展潜力,一旦发展成功收获德更多。一般创业型公司更加看重的是大项目的经验,所以需要多积累点儿项目经验,同时,需要熟悉整个项目的运作流程等等。
如果是想去大型企业
很多人跳槽想去大公司,不仅是薪资高,待遇也比较好。但大公司不好进,一般来说,进入大企业,需要你具备良好的沟通协作能力和技术实力,你的技术体系需要得到公司的认可。
如果说技术达到了,还是没能进入,这就需要掌握一些“技巧”了,比如,你可以多在技术平台上发言,提出你自己的解决方案和自己的一些思考等,或者是多帮助其他程序员解决问题。因为成为一名顶尖程序员,不仅仅是需要你的技术。